1. What manipulations to the camera will you need to make to create an HDR image? Manipulations that I will have to make will include changing the shutter speed and  apeture to expose light and underexpose light so that it can be blended in photoshop. 2. What equipment will we use to take this type of image? Equipment that I will need to get this type of image is a nice scenic place. Another important equipment that is very important is a tripod which will allow the picture to be stable. 3. What is the reason someone might take an HDR image? Someone might take a HDR  image because it helps an image pop. For instance, some professions like relators and business owners may use HDR image to advertise their product or business. HDR pictures help a picture look better and pretty as well as 3D which  might  help catch ones attention.  4.
